AD06 EUF is a 2006 Volkswagen Sharan in Black with a 1,896c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2006 Volkswagen Sharan models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.3% with a typical mileage of 106,508 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Sharan f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 37,436 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AD06 EUF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volkswagen Sharan typ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 20 years old, this Volkswagen Sharan is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
